Company Overview

NAPCO Security Technologies, Inc. is one of the world’s leading manufacturers and solutions providers of high-technology electronic security, connected home, video, fire alarm, access control and door locking systems. The Company consists of four Divisions: NAPCO, it’s security and connected home segment, plus three wholly-owned subsidiaries: Alarm Lock, Continental Instruments, and Marks USA. Headquartered in Amityville, New York, its products are installed by tens of thousands of security professionals worldwide in commercial, industrial, institutional, residential and government applications. Since 1969, NAPCO products have earned a reputation for innovation, technical excellence and reliability, positioning the Company for growth in the multi-billion dollar and rapidly expanding electronic security market. The Company is a diversified developer and manufacturer of security products, including electronic locking devices, intrusion and fire alarms and building access control systems, as well as an innovative “Connected Home” product suite. . These products are used for commercial, residential, institutional, industrial and governmental applications, and are sold worldwide principally to independent distributors, dealers, integrators and installers of security equipment.

NAPCO SECURITY SYSTEMS - introduced the industry’s first smart, flexible micro-processor-based alarm system, sporting a revolutionary, user-friendly digital keypad, over 15 years ago. Now, NAPCO is well-respected worldwide for creating many innovative and reliable products, in the intrusion and fire industry. There are two new revolutionary products from NAPCO that have been recently introduced. One is the patented Freedom 64, which is the world’s first “codeless” alarm system for buildings, that eliminates false alarms and is as simple to use as locking one’s door. The second is the iSee Video, a Plug-and-Play Internet Interface, a new reoccurring revenue producer for alarm companies. It offers the consumer remote video from anywhere in the world on a cell phone or computer and presents crystal clear, real time video of one’s home and business. No computer or software is required on the premise.

ALARM LOCK SYSTEMS - was acquired and is a wholly-owned subsidiary and producer of a comprehensive line of highly regarded push button and ID card operated electronic locks, door exit alarms and door security hardware. Vast advancements in these products have been made and it is currently one of the Company’s fastest growing divisions.

CONTINENTAL ACCESS SYSTEMS - is a wholly-owned subsidiary and producer of an advanced line of PC-driven building Access Control systems and peripherals, featuring multiple card technology integration, multi-tasking software and intuitive report generation. Continental’s technologically-advanced access control systems span the full range of capabilities from multi-doors, to enterprise-class LAN/WAN systems, all supporting myriad ID card- and badge-, fingerprint-, hand geometry and vein & retinal-scanning technology readers.

MARKS USA - is the latest acquisition to the Napco family of companies, Marks USA was established in 1977 manufacturing mortise locks to meet the needs of an expanding market. Since then,Marks USA has grown and expanded their product line to include residential, institutional and commerical locksets to meet and exceed the most stringent UL and ANSI specifications.

CUSTOM MANUFACTURING - is another strategic growth initiative for NAPCO. Adding custom manufacturing to the product mix has served to increase capacity utilization at NAPCO’s manufacturing facilities, improving overall efficiencies and economies of scale. Sharing product design and manufacturing expertise with large security installation companies are not only potentially profitable, but also keeps NAPCO on the forefront of converging technologies.
